Discrepancy:
- A Discrepancy is when there is a mismatch or inconsistency between the expected and actual conditions of a load. This is noted by the receiver when the load begins offload at the receiving facility. The load is not offloaded and received until the discrepancy is resolved.
- For example, the waste details (code and classification) of a load on the manifest, are different than the actual received contents of the waste

- A discrepancy is a receiver initiated process

Dispute:
- A Dispute is when there is a mismatch or inconsistency between the expected and actual conditions of the offload details (volumes, cuts etc.). This is noted by the generator after the load has been received, offloaded, and the cuts have been added to WiQ.
- A dispute is a generator initiated process

Discrepancy Process in WiQ
- The discrepancy process is a set of procedures followed to identify, document, notify, investigate, resolve, and report on a discrepancy.
- In WiQ, there are three (3) main actions that need to occur during the discrepancy process
1. Receiver Raises a Discrepancy
2. Generator Resolves the Discrepancy
3. Receiver Approves the Resolution
